Responsibilities
- Provide basic patient care under the supervision of RNs and physicians.
- Administer medications, monitor vital signs, and record patient observations.
- Assist with wound care, catheter insertion, and other clinical tasks.
- Support patients with hygiene, mobility, and nutrition needs.
- Maintain accurate documentation and comply with facility and HIPAA standards.
- Communicate effectively with patients, families, and interdisciplinary teams.
